OEM Readers

A small‑form‑factor device that combines a 3‑track magnetic stripe secure card reader authenticator with contact EMV chip reading, and can be paired with DynaWave to add contactless/NFC capabilities, offering a flexible hybrid solution.

The IP34-rated mDynamo with Outdoor Bezel is a compact EMV chip card reading module built on the MagneSafe security architecture, featuring a spring‑loaded door to block dust and moisture for reliable integration into both indoor and outdoor unattended kiosks.

A manually operated, push‑in magnetic stripe reader that minimizes incorrect card insertion with an optional dual‑head design and an open‑frame construction that keeps the card slot free of debris, available in TTL, RS‑232, and USB interfaces.

oDynamo is a PCI PTS 5.x SRED‑certified, secure insertion card reader authenticator for OEM solutions that reads both magnetic stripe and EMV contact chip data, supports USB, Ethernet, and RS‑232 connections, and features a sealed, liquid‑impervious chassis designed for harsh unattended environments like gas pumps, ATMs, and vending machines.

Secure card reader authenticator that reads up to three tracks from ISO and AAMVA cards, featuring a sealed, tamper‑resistant design for unattended and outdoor installations.

OEM Components

The first magnetic sensing, media-validating, tamper-resistant security module that reads three tracks of magnetic stripe data, encrypts it inside the head using 3DES and DUKPT, and authenticates cards with MagnePrint technology to help OEMs meet stringent PCI security requirements.

High-performance, low-cost three-channel magnetic stripe decoder chips that significantly simplify the card-reader-to-micro-controller interface, including the Delta ASIC (proven for three-track reading) and the next-generation Qwantum ASIC with integrated encryption, SPI support, and ultra-low power modes.

An EMV contact chip card reader module that connects via USB, features two optional auxiliary ports (SPI and UART) to easily add magnetic stripe or contactless/NFC reading, and is built on the MagneSafe Security Architecture for secure chip card transactions.

A compact bidirectional magnetic stripe swipe reader available in USB keyboard emulation or HID format, designed for low‑cost, high‑reliability card reading in payment, membership, loyalty, and identification applications.

Highly efficient three-channel fully integrated magnetic stripe decoder chips (including the Delta and Qwantum families) that simplify the card-reader-to-micro-controller interface via MagTek's "Shift-Out" protocol while supporting advanced features like integrated encryption, SPI, and USB-C connectivity.

Modular card guide rails that work with MagTek’s IntelliHead product line (including the encrypted MagneSafe™ IntelliHead) to provide a complete card swipe assembly in lengths such as 43mm, 60mm, 70mm, and 90mm for various OEM integration needs.

A low-profile magnetic read head with an embedded high-performance multi-channel decoder chip that outputs raw track data using the simple "Shift-Out" protocol (data/strobe), making it ideal for battery-powered or microcontrollers where minimal power consumption is critical.
